Ticket #2290 — Expired credential halting dedup batch runs

The nightly job that deduplicates customer records in the Harborlyn CRM has failed three consecutive runs. Root cause: the service credential for the internal matching engine, Twinsolve, expired on the 3rd. No duplicates were merged incorrectly; the job simply aborted at auth. Release manager sign-off is needed before the fix ships with build 7.4.2. The replacement key for Twinsolve appears below.

gateway credential: kto7_GoY89Me

Items: Training budget proposal reviewed. Request of 4% uplift over current year, driven by the Skillbridge certification rollout and onboarding for the Varnholt site. Finance flagged overlap with existing vendor contracts; procurement to consolidate. Board asked for headcount-linked metrics before approval. Revised figures due in two weeks. Decision deferred to next session. For board reference, the confidential note on related business plans appears directly below.

internal memo for hahif-hahaf: Headcount on the Zorwyn team goes from 9 to 100 by the end of October. Gross margin on Zorwyn came in at 5 percent against a plan of 10 percent.

Pilot results show acceptable resolution rates and a projected 22% cost reduction. Tier-two support remains in-house. Transition is scheduled over fourteen weeks, with knowledge-transfer workshops beginning next month. Affected staff will be offered redeployment where possible. Department heads should prepare impact assessments. The confidential commercial terms and planning note are appended below.

confidential, bahap-bajog: Zorethix Works is in early talks to buy Kelethox Foods for about $30.7 million. The Ralvan launch date is September 19, and nothing goes to the press before then.

MEMO — Finance Team

Re: Q3 Cash-Flow Forecast

The Q3 forecast for Harlowe Systems shows net operating inflows of 2.4m, down 6% on prior quarter, driven by slower collections from the Verdane account and the phased billing on the Kestrel rollout. Payables remain stable. We expect a temporary dip in the September cash position before the Q4 ramp. Assumptions and sensitivities are in the shared model. One item should be treated as strictly confidential and is noted below.

management briefing: Project Ulavan slips by two quarters because of the staffing delay.